Alen Stajcic (born 2 November 1973) is a former semi-professional football (soccer) player and now is a full-time Football coach. While a footballer he was a NSW Premier League player and Australian Youth Representative before a career-ending knee injury. Since he has turned his hand to coaching he has become Head Coach of NSWIS for Women's Soccer and Head Coach of the Australian Under 20 Women's National Team. He was appointed coach for Sydney FC in the first season of the Australian W-League.
